24 January 1940 – 15 June 2018
Daniel G. Neuman of Stouffville ON. Born in Paris, France 24 January 1940 and passed away in Newmarket 15 June 2018. Beloved husband of Anne (Heath), loving father of Michelle (Steve Quinn), Scott (Karen Greenwood), Christopher and Timothy. Loving grandfather to Kaitlyn Quinn and Jack Neuman. Special Uncle to Victoria Heath. He will be missed by extended family and many friends. Predeceased by Mother, Sarah Mittnacht Neuman and sister Christine Neuman Belliveau.
Daniel was owner of Ice Photo Studios for 51 years. He also owned and operated the Lighthouse & Beach Motel, Souris PEI for 28 summers (1987-2015). In his youth he was involved with figure skating and often travelled with the Canadian Team to competitions taking photographs of the skaters for the newspapers. Roller Skating was another passion of Daniel's. He was proud to be in the Maple Leaf's dressing room in 1967 after the team won the Stanley Cup and where he met Prime Minister Lester B. Pearson. Daniel was also an honorary member of the Faustina Sports Club. We will miss his humour, passion and dedication for life's opportunities.
